A New Departure, 1882. The Chief Secretary for Ireland, William Forster, resigns from his office in Mr Gladstone's Liberal government. This happened because he was unable to accept that Gladstone had been engaging in talks with Charles Parnell of the Irish Nationalist Party without even informing him, let alone involving him. Gladstone had been trying to reach an agreement whereby he would arrange for Parnell to be released from prison where he had been languishing for some weeks after his arrest for breaching the recent coercion legislation. In return, Parnell would endeavour to ensure the success of Gladstone's hard won Land Act. From Punch, or the London Charivari, May 13, 1882.
